Comments about Aqua Hawk Eye Handheld Digital Sonar System, DF2200PX:
The product is great for many of the dives we do. If I am doing a wall dive, I use it to surface swim to the depth I want, then drop right onto the wall. I've loaned it to friends to find the walls at many of our dives... In addition, great for divesite mapping. Two person endeavor, but not tide dependant. Shore buddy uses range finder on you as you surface kick calling out depths.As a side note, it does float... so expect it to bump into things as you dive, a lanyard is the best choice. It's not for every dive, but wall dives and mapping are great options. I did use it in some low vis pacific northwest diving (1-2ft). It worked great for locating my lost diving buddy (7 feet away).

First bad review I have ever written...
By TheCatcher
from Yorba Linda, CA
The first one of these I owned worked for about 20 minutes on my first beach dive. It leaked through the switch mechanism, straight onto the circuit board. Norcross Marine support recommended I upgrade to the latest model, which had a better seal around the front of the unit (but the seal around the front of the unit didn't have a problem). I upgraded, the newer unit lasted about 6 minutes in the swimming pool, before it also leaked onto the circuit board through the switch mechanism (they didn't change the switch mechanism's seal on the newer version).Handheld sonars from other manufacturers use switches that do not penetrate the case and cause potential points of failure. The Vexilar LPS-1 that I currently own doesn't have as many features. But it doesn't leak when you turn it on and off. I have used it on about 20 dives, the label wore off but it continues to work fine. I highly recommend handheld sonars, just not this one. In 10 foot or less vis, it is very cool to drop right on target after swimming for hundreds of yards to get there.
